The Whisper of Well-being: What Exactly Are Endorphins?

To truly appreciate the transformative power of endorphins, we must first understand what they are. The name itself offers a clue: "endorphin" is a portmanteau of "endogenous morphine." "Endogenous" means originating from within the body, and "morphine" refers to their potent opioid-like effects. Produced primarily in the pituitary gland and hypothalamus, these neurochemicals are essentially the body’s natural painkillers and pleasure-inducers.

Unlike external drugs, endorphins don’t just mask symptoms; they work in harmony with our body’s intricate systems. When released, they bind to opioid receptors throughout the brain and nervous system, similar to how opioid medications operate. This binding action triggers a cascade of effects: a reduction in pain perception, a feeling of euphoria, and a general sense of well-being. There are several types of endorphins, with beta-endorphins being the most extensively studied and potent, often associated with the well-known "runner’s high." Enkephalins and dynorphins also play crucial roles, contributing to various aspects of pain modulation and emotional regulation.

Their very existence is a testament to evolution’s genius. Imagine our ancestors, facing the harsh realities of survival – injury, famine, predation. A mechanism that could alleviate pain in the face of a wound, allowing for escape, or provide a burst of energy and optimism to continue the hunt, would be invaluable. Endorphins are not a luxury; they are a fundamental part of our survival toolkit, designed to help us cope with stress, overcome adversity, and reinforce behaviors beneficial for our species, such as social bonding and physical activity.

Nature’s Analgesic: The Endorphin Pain Relief System

The historical search for effective pain relief has driven much of medical science, from ancient herbal remedies to modern pharmaceuticals. Yet, our bodies possess an inherent, sophisticated pain management system, with endorphins at its core. Their capacity to block pain signals is not just a fascinating biological quirk; it’s a profound mechanism that has ensured our survival and continues to offer hope for those suffering from chronic pain.

Acute Pain: The Emergency Response: When we experience acute pain – a sudden injury, a burn, or a traumatic event – the body’s immediate response is often a rush of adrenaline, but also a surge of endorphins. This natural analgesic effect is critical. It allows us to function, to escape danger, or to endure a necessary medical procedure. Consider a soldier wounded in battle who continues to fight, or a mother in labor enduring intense contractions. In these moments, the body’s internal pharmacy kicks in, dulling the sharp edges of pain, providing a temporary window of increased tolerance and focus. This isn’t to say the pain isn’t real, but its perceived intensity is significantly mitigated, allowing for crucial actions.

Chronic Pain: A Path to Mitigation: The application of endorphin science to chronic pain management is particularly exciting. Conditions like fibromyalgia, arthritis, back pain, and migraines can be debilitating, often leading to a cycle of reduced activity, increased pain, and emotional distress. While external pain medications can offer relief, they often come with side effects and the risk of dependence. Endorphin-boosting activities offer a natural, empowering alternative or complement.

Regular, moderate exercise, for instance, can significantly reduce the perception of chronic pain. It’s a paradox for many: moving when you hurt seems counterintuitive. But the sustained release of endorphins during physical activity creates an analgesic effect that can last for hours after the activity ceases. Moreover, the improved mood, better sleep, and reduced stress that accompany an endorphin-rich lifestyle further contribute to a holistic reduction in pain experience. Laughter therapy, acupuncture (which is believed to stimulate endorphin release), and even practices like meditation and mindfulness can all tap into this innate pain-relief system, offering individuals tools to manage their pain more effectively and reclaim a sense of control over their bodies.

The Health Ripple Effect: Beyond Immediate Gratification

The influence of endorphins extends far beyond mood elevation and pain relief, creating a positive ripple effect throughout our entire physiological system. This makes an endorphin-rich lifestyle a powerful strategy for overall health optimization.

Bolstering the Immune System: The intricate link between mind and body is nowhere more evident than in the immune system. Chronic stress, anxiety, and depression are known to suppress immune function, leaving us more vulnerable to illness. By reducing stress hormones and promoting a positive emotional state, endorphins indirectly bolster our immune defenses. A robust immune system is better equipped to fight off infections, repair cellular damage, and maintain overall health. Some research even suggests a more direct link, where endorphins may modulate immune cell activity, further enhancing our body’s protective mechanisms.

The Sweet Embrace of Sleep: For millions, a good night’s sleep remains an elusive dream. Pain, anxiety, and stress are major culprits in sleep disturbances. Endorphin-boosting activities can dramatically improve sleep quality. By reducing pain, calming an overactive mind, and promoting relaxation, endorphins help us fall asleep more easily and achieve deeper, more restorative sleep cycles. This, in turn, has a cascading effect: improved sleep enhances mood, boosts energy, aids cognitive function, and further strengthens the immune system – a virtuous cycle of well-being.

Sharpening the Mind: Cognitive Enhancement: The brain, our command center, also benefits significantly from an endorphin surge. When we are less stressed, less anxious, and experiencing less pain, our cognitive faculties operate more efficiently. Endorphins contribute to improved focus, enhanced memory, and better problem-solving abilities. The clarity of thought that often follows a good workout or a session of deep laughter is not just a feeling; it’s a physiological reality. Moreover, physical activity, a major endorphin trigger, is known to promote neurogenesis – the growth of new brain cells – particularly in areas associated with learning and memory.

Managing Cravings and Addictions: While a complex topic, endorphins play a role in the brain’s reward system, which is intimately involved in addiction. The natural "high" provided by endorphins can, for some, serve as a healthier alternative to the artificial highs sought through addictive substances or behaviors. By providing a natural source of pleasure and reward, endorphin-boosting activities can help rewire the brain’s reward pathways, making healthier behaviors more appealing and reducing the pull of destructive cravings. This is why exercise is often a crucial component of addiction recovery programs.
